REV: 11-22-2021 SK <br />AMENDMENT NO. 1 <br />TO AGREEMENT FOR SERVICES <br /> (Child Care Coordinating Council of San Mateo County) <br />This Amendment No. 1 (the “Amendment No. 1”) is entered into and effective as <br />of _______________ 2021, by and between the City of Redwood City, a charter city and <br />municipal corporation of the State of California (“City”), and Child Care Coordinating <br />Council of San Mateo County, a California nonprofit organization (“Subrecipient”) <br />(collectively, the “Parties”). <br />RECITALS <br />A. The Parties previously executed that certain COVID-19 Child Care Provider <br />Assistance Agreement dated as of April 15, 2021, (the “Agreement”). <br />B. The Parties have negotiated and agreed to the terms and conditions set <br />forth in this Amendment No. 1, including any terms and conditions of the attached Exhibit <br />A, incorporated herein by reference.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of these recitals and the mutual covenants <br />contained herein, the Parties agree as follows: <br />1. Subrecipient will provide services subject to the revisions to the activity and <br />program budget set forth in Exhibit “A”, and such services will be considered part of the <br />Services for purposes of the Agreement. <br />2. All other provisions of the Agreement will remain in full force and effect. <br />3. All requisite insurance policies to be maintained by Subrecipient pursuant <br />to the Agreement will include coverage for this Amendment No. 1. <br />4. The individuals executing this Amendment No. 1 and the instruments <br />referenced in it on behalf of Subrecipient each represent and warrant that they have the <br />legal power, right and actual authority to bind Subrecipient to the terms and conditions of <br />this Amendment No. 1. <br />5. If all Parties agree, electronic signatures may be used in place of original <br />signatures on this Amendment No. 1. Each Party intends to be bound by the signatures <br />on the electronic document, is aware that the other Parties will rely on the electronic <br />signatures, and hereby waives any defenses to the enforcement of the terms of this <br />Amendment No. 1 based on the use of an electronic signature. After all Parties agree to <br />the use of electronic signatures, all Parties must sign the document electronically. <br />[The remainder of this page left intentionally blank] <br />ATTY/AGR.2021 - Amend No. 1/Child Card Coordinating Council of San Mateo County (Page 1 of 3) <br />December 9
